Ulysses designs, manufactures, and operates autonomous surface and subsea vehicles for defense, commercial, and scientific missions. Our platform spans Mako (a modular autonomous underwater vehicle with 60-hour endurance), Leviathan (an autonomous surface mothership), and Kraken (an automated launch-and-recovery system).
Founded in 2023 and based in San Francisco, we've raised $48M from Andreessen Horowitz, Booz Allen Ventures, Harpoon Ventures, Pebblebed, and Lowercarbon Capital. We work with partners including the U.S. Navy, the Government of Australia, and the Great Barrier Reef Foundation. We prototype in the shop, test on the water, and ship.
You'll build the robots that go into the ocean. Starting with parts and subassemblies, you'll assemble, inspect, and test complete vehicles, working directly with engineers to solve build problems and make the next robot easier to produce.
The core of the job is ownership: know what you're building, check your work, and leave a clear record of what went into each robot. You'll help turn early builds into a production process that delivers reliable hardware at scale, improving the tools, fixtures, and instructions as you go.
Build robots: Assemble mechanical and electromechanical systems, including housings, seals, propulsion, batteries, sensors, and wiring, from drawings, bills of materials, and work instructions.
Organisation and Inventory: Keep the production space organised (kitted, clean, ESD safe), manage component tracing and procurement.
Get the details right: Check fit, alignment, fastener torque, cable routing, and seal installation. Spot damaged parts or unclear instructions before they become a problem in the water.
Inspect and test: Inspect incoming parts and completed assemblies; run leak checks and functional tests using documented procedures, and record the results.
Troubleshoot and rework: Find the cause of assembly and test failures, carry out tests. Complete agreed repairs, and work with engineering when a problem needs a design change.
Keep builds traceable: Record part revisions, serial numbers, build steps, test results, and rework so we know exactly what went into each vehicle.
Keep production moving: Prepare build kits, track parts and consumables, flag shortages early, and keep tools and workstations organized and ready.
Improve the process: Help develop assembly fixtures and test setups, improve work instructions, and suggest changes that reduce build time and prevent repeat mistakes.
Feed learning back: Show engineers where a design is difficult to assemble, inspect, or service, and help prove out improvements on the next build.
Documentation: Maintain build instructions, rework notes, and test procedures; feed recurring issues back to engineering.
